tupe issues
When a business is bought or sold, or a contract to provide services is lost or won, there are usually implications for employees. The Transfer of Undertakings (Protection of Employment) Regulations (TUPE) protect the terms and conditions of employment of staff who are facing such situations – automatically transferring their rights and obligations from one business to another. TUPE regulations may also impose a duty to inform and consult with employees regarding the transfer.
